I think the point that Leemon is getting at is that Hashgraph is a completely different algorithm / data structure than blockchain at the very foundation of the distributed ledger applications that are being built. EOS is a distributed ledger application and is therefore far more than just a blockchain. What Leemon suggests is that if these applications like EOS are modular enough, then you could swap out the blockchain algorithm at the foundation for a Hashgraph algorithm. This is already happening with Lykke. They are implementing Hashgraph at the core of their architecture as far as I'm aware.
